From 426f243d92df9b599f0ada175c385dba3945211c Mon Sep 17 00:00:00 2001 From: Puneet Singla Date: Wed, 15 Aug 2018 15:50:44 +0530 Subject: [PATCH] Update MainActivity.java 10 digit mobile number exceeded the range of int data type so changed to long. --- .../com/beginner/micromaster/contactlist/MainActivity.java |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/MicroMaster_ContactList-FinalCodeExercise_Lesson1/app/src/main/java/com/beginner/micromaster/contactlist/MainActivity.java b/MicroMaster_ContactList-FinalCodeExercise_Lesson1/app/src/main/java/com/beginner/micromaster/contactlist/MainActivity.java index 72f8cac..e4fed43 100755 --- a/MicroMaster_ContactList-FinalCodeExercise_Lesson1/app/src/main/java/com/beginner/micromaster/contactlist/MainActivity.java +++ b/MicroMaster_ContactList-FinalCodeExercise_Lesson1/app/src/main/java/com/beginner/micromaster/contactlist/MainActivity.java @@ -37,7 +37,7 @@ public void onClick(View v) { String phoneNumber = phoneNumberEditText.getText().toString(); //Get values from EditText and create a new Contact - Integer phoneNumberInt = parsePhoneNumber(phoneNumber); + Long phoneNumberInt = Long.parseLong(phoneNumber); if (phoneNumberInt != null) { createNewContact(name, lastName, email, phoneNumberInt); } @@ -45,7 +45,7 @@ public void onClick(View v) { }); } - private void createNewContact(String name, String lastName, String email, Integer phoneNumber) { + private void createNewContact(String name, String lastName, String email, long phoneNumber) { Contact contact = new Contact(name, lastName, email, phoneNumber); Log.d(TAG, "New contact created: " + contact.toString()); clearEditText();